Citroën - RU23 Currus - 1949
Citroen RU23 hearse, body by Currus, from 1949, complete and driving, normal registration, without MOT, original 30,000 km, it was owned a funeral home in Paris. Acquired in 1995, it came from Régi Film - second hand cinema wardrobes, weapons and props. This vehicle can be found in many documentaries: - Ciné-Archives photos: Funeral ceremony for the nine of Charonne on 13/02/1962. - Photos 3 and 4, reference visible on You. Tube on 10/10/2014 "La mort et les obsèques d'Edith Piaf". - Photos 5 and 6: Funeral of Maurice Thorez: Ciné-archives. - Photo 7: Funeral of Josephine Baker. Probably the only survivor of the two identical floats, See last photo which was published in Citropolis on 15/09/2001. Due to its rarity and being a true part of the French heritage, this vehicle deserves our full attention.
